Superior Industries International has announced the appointment of Matti Masanovich as executive vice president and chief financial officer (CFO), effective Sept. 16.

Prior to joining Superior, Masanovich was the senior vice president and CFO at General Cable Corp., from November 2016 to July 2018. Previously, he served as the vice president and controller of International Automotive Components from August 2016 to October 2016. From November 2013 to April 2016, Masanovich served as global vice president of finance, Packard Electrical and Electronic Architecture (E/EA) Division in Shanghai, at Aptiv (formerly Delphi Automotive), an automotive technology company. Masanovich previously served in various executive positions with both public and private companies.
Masanovich began his career in public accounting at Coopers & Lybrand (from 1994-1997) and P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P (from 1997-2001). He holds a Bachelor of Commerce degree and a Master of Business Administration degree from the University of Windsor. Masanovich also is a Chartered Accountant.
